"Let the word of Christ dwell in you richly."— Colossians 3:16 But how can God’s Word dwell in us if we haven’t memorized it? How can it comfort and guide us if it doesn’t live in our hearts?  In Memorize Scripture, Catholic speaker, podcaster, and worship leader Jackie Francois Angel invites you on a 12-month journey into the timeless beauty and transformative power of scripture memorization. With 120 carefully selected verses, each organized into 12 thematic chapters, Jackie equips you with practical tools to make memorization simple, meaningful, and accessible.  Drawing from her own experiences of falling in love with God’s Word, Jackie reveals hidden treasures within each verse—uncovering layers of wisdom that have illuminated her own faith journey. From the comforting embrace of Psalms to the profound teachings of the Gospels, Jackie shares firsthand how scripture can become a constant companion, echoing in your heart and guiding your every step.  Every chapter begins with a heartfelt reflection from Jackie and walks you through her simple, step-by-step process: Pray: Begin by inviting God into your heart through prayer as you prepare to memorize His Word. Ponder: Reflect on the meaning and significance of each verse using Jackie’s thoughtful prompts to dive deeper into scripture’s wisdom. Memorize: Use Jackie’s proven tips and techniques to make scripture memorization accessible and rewarding. Practice: Solidify your memorization with interactive exercises. Each chapter provides space for copy work and journaling to help you integrate scripture into your daily life.     Whether you’re new to scripture or have been reading the Bible for years, Jackie’s approachable style will inspire you to dive deeper into your faith. As you commit each verse to memory, you’ll find that God’s Word becomes more than something you recite—it becomes a living, breathing part of who you are, strengthening you on your daily journey with God and drawing you closer to his heart.

    German pianist Hedda Schlagel's world collapsed when her fiancé, Fritz, vanished after being sent to an enemy alien camp in the United States during the Great War. Fifteen years later, in 1932, Hedda is stunned to see Fritz's name in a photograph of an American memorial for German seamen who died near Asheville, North Carolina. Determined to reclaim his body and bring closure to his ailing mother, Hedda travels to the US. Her quest takes a shocking turn when, rather than Fritz's body, his casket contains the remains of a woman who died under mysterious circumstances. 
     
    Local deputy Garland Jones thought he'd left that dark chapter behind when he helped bury Fritz Meyer's coffin. The unexpected arrival of Hedda, a long-suffering yet captivating woman, forces him to confront how much of the truth he really knows. As they work together to uncover the identity of the woman in the casket and to unravel Fritz's fate, Hedda and Garland grow closer. But with Hedda in the US on borrowed time while Hitler rises to power in Germany, she fears she'll be forced to return home before she can put the ghosts of her past to rest.

    Why did Jesus die? 
    Did Jesus die so that God could forgive us for our sins? Many believe so.  
    The most ancient view of the atonement teaches that Jesus did not die to appease the wrath of God or gain forgiveness for human sin, but rather to defeat sin, death, and the devil, and reveal to us the unconditional love and grace of God. This was a Non-Violent view of the atonement. Yes, the death of Jesus was violent, but the violence was not because God needed blood to pay the debt of sin. It is not God who killed Jesus to satisfy God’s wrath toward sin. Jesus died for completely different reasons.  
    Due to various circumstances in church history, this view fell out of favor for much of Christian history, but Non-Violent views of the atonement are making a comeback today. 
    In this book, J. D. Myers presents three of the common violent views of the atonement, and then explains and defends the core ideas of the Non-Violent view, which is often referred to as the Christus Victor view. 
    Following this explanation of the Non-Violent view of the atonement, J. D. Myers shows how this view of the atonement sheds light on numerous other areas of theology as well, such as our view of God, Scripture, humanity, sin, forgiveness, violence, and justice. A Non-Violent view of the atonement has great ramifications on nearly every area of theology.
